Competition Notes
1. Each team will play at least 5, 50 minute matches over the weekend with a 30 second timeout at the 25 minute mark to reset lineups. The score table will be keeping a flip score (because everyone cares about score) and for situational purposes ALTHOUGH THERE IS NO OFFICIAL SCORES REPORTED for results or future seeding purposes. At the end of 25 minutes, the score will be reset to 0-0 regardless of the outcome to begin the 2nd set. If a team exceeds 25 points before the 25 minute mark, play will continue.
2. All teams are placed in pools to play against like opponents, there are no direct results, brackets or flow charts.
3. Uniforms are optional for Jamboree, many clubs do not yet have their uniforms yet. Team shirts with or without number are recommended if you will not be using traditional uniforms. Players playing the libero position MUST wear a jersey or shirt that is distinctly different than standard players.
4. Teams assigned to Ref need to provide an R2, line judges and athletes to work the score desk. This is a great opportunity to teach your athletes to R2 in a semi-competitive environment. Keeping an official scoresheet and libero tracking is suggested for learning purposes but not required because there are no official scores. We are scheduled to have R1 officials from PSBO for all matches. There are no protests allowed in WCVBA Jamboree.
5. There are unlimited substitutions, please be reasonable. Coaches should treat substitutions as they would in a standard match. A team may use 2 libero’s in each 25 minute segment.
6. Each team is allowed to take 1, 30 second timeout during each 25 minute segment. Coaches may coach on court during these timeouts.
7. Warm up will be 5 minutes per team for the first match per day and 3 minutes per team for all subsequent matches.
